NIH researchers identify genetic elements influencing the risk of type 2 diabetes

Wednesday, November 3, 2010 - 07:01 in Biology & Nature

A team led by researchers at the National Human Genome Research Institute (NHGRI), part of the National Institutes of Health, has captured the most comprehensive snapshot to date of DNA regions that regulate genes in human pancreatic islet cells, a subset of which produces insulin...
